Taking a look at helping disadvantaged kids advance

Various things to know about the types of charity that are supporting young people who are faced with social and financial discrepancies.

In today's society, many children are constrained by economic disparities and social disadvantages. Issues such as poverty and inadequate access to resources considerably impact their ability to connect with valuable opportunities and economic security. As access to healthcare and adequate nutrition can be a challenge for many, organisations and charities are helping disadvantaged communities by providing well-being solutions for those who are vulnerable. Charities can assist by organising medical centers to provide check ups and vaccinations, in addition to diet and mental health programs that provide better assistance for the community. Likewise, social development is an ongoing difficulty for many children, which is why athletics programs and creative channels, including art and music, are vital for helping underprivileged youth to learn new skills and gain confidence. By managing these areas, children can become equipped to lead healthier and more successful lives.

Knowing how to help disadvantaged children calls for specialised and purposeful efforts to eliminate social discrepancies and deal with the concerns of the community. But unfortunately, for kids with disabilities, there are often more unique difficulties and issues which can limit their progression in society. Charitable organizations are recognising that children with disabilities are encountering issues when it comes to education, health care and social inclusion. A number of charities work towards providing more inclusive opportunities by creating special education programs and assistive solutions that provide for kids with diverse learning needs. As kids with disabilities get older, they also require more inclusive opportunities to develop independence and economic stability. Charity efforts are working towards teaching employment coaching and professional assistance that are tailored to their distinct situations, as well as collaborating with companies to create more inclusive workplaces.

Throughout history, charities have played a major role in improving the experiences of underprivileged young people by offering the required materials and opportunities for growth. For many groups a key area of concentration is youth education. Education is among the most effective means for improving social mobility and stopping the cycle of poverty. Many organisations and industry executives put great importance on academic discrepancies and make countless initiatives to bring about better opportunities for disadvantaged young people. Initiatives such as scholarships and grants for disadvantaged youth help young people manage tuition in addition to books and school equipment. In addition, lots of charities provide extracurricular assistance, which include tutoring and mentorship, to lessen the effects of inequalities and promote academic prosperity.
